Essays
in Later Medieval French History
P.S. Lewis
P.S. Lewis's work has done much to make the
history of Prance in the later middle ages more accessible to the English
reader and to establish new lines of enquiry and interpretation. The book's
central theme is the physical and mental structure of French politics in
the period. Following a general survey, the author illustrates his arguments
by examining a series of institutions, attitudes and ideas.
